RUS  ENG
Full version
JOURNALS // Proceedings of the Institute for System Programming of the RAS // Archive

Proceedings of ISP RAS, 2022 Volume 34, Issue 4, Pages 211–228 (Mi tisp715)

Requirements and architecture design for cloud PaaS orchestrator

N. A. Lazarev, O. D. Borisenko

Ivannikov Institute for System Programming of the RAS

Abstract: Cloud technologies provide abilities for simple and reliable scaling of resources, due to which they have become widespread. The task of managing distributed services in a cloud environment is especially relevant today. Special programs are used for that purpose named “orchestrators” which implement the functions of lifecycle management for applications. However, the existing solutions have many limitations and are not applicable in the general case. Also there is no single standard or protocol for interaction with such tools which requires adaptation of programs for each particular case. The main objectives of this paper are to identify the requirements for a platform-level cloud computing (PaaS) orchestrator, as well as to propose flexible architecture patterns for such tools.

Keywords: cloud computing, orchestration, PaaS, distributed systems, TOSCA, OCCI

DOI: 10.15514/ISPRAS-2022-34(4)-15



© Steklov Math. Inst. of RAS, 2024